Detailed Review
Otium Word: Relax Puzzle Game positions itself in the crowded word game market by combining multiple puzzle formats with atmospheric relaxation elements. Developed by Palmax Group Limited, this iOS application merges traditional word search mechanics with modern connection puzzles and crossword elements, all wrapped in visually calming environments. The app's core premise revolves around providing mental stimulation while maintaining a stress-free gaming experience, distinguishing itself through its dual focus on cognitive exercise and relaxation.
The application features three primary gameplay modes: word search puzzles where users locate hidden terms in letter grids, word connection challenges that require linking adjacent letters to form words, and crossword-style puzzles with contextual clues. Each mode incorporates progressive difficulty scaling, with later levels introducing longer words, complex letter arrangements, and time-based challenges. The game implements a star-based reward system for completing puzzles with bonus words, which can be used to unlock new scenery packs and hint systems. Technical performance remains stable with smooth animations and responsive touch controls, though some users report occasional advertisement interruptions between levels.
User experience centers around the app's minimalist interface design, which employs soft color palettes and intuitive navigation. The scrolling letter grids respond accurately to swipe gestures, while the hint system provides contextual assistance without solving puzzles outright. Real-world usage patterns show most players engage in short sessions of 5-10 minutes, often during breaks or commuting, with the ambient background music and nature-themed visuals contributing to the relaxed atmosphere. The absence of aggressive timers in standard modes allows for contemplative gameplay, though competitive players can opt into timed challenges for increased difficulty.

The application demonstrates notable strengths in its cohesive design philosophy and varied puzzle types, providing substantial content for word game enthusiasts. Limitations include relatively predictable bonus word patterns and occasional repetitive background scenes. The advertising implementation, while not overly intrusive, may disrupt immersion for some users. Ideal use cases include casual mental exercise during short breaks, vocabulary building for non-native speakers, and stress-free cognitive stimulation for older audiences seeking engaging yet relaxed gameplay experiences.
